He was born without arms or legs in 1982 Australia however, this didn't stop him from getting a degree with a double major in accounting and financial planning. It also hasn't stopped him from making huge sums of money that those who lost their homes, their jobs or even had other possessions repo'ed don't have or they wouldn't be where they are. Remember, there is a big difference in having something to lose and never having had it in the first place. This man is a preacher, a motivational speaker and director of the non-profit organization known as Life without Limbs. He has no doubt had to deal with many shortcomings throughout his life but he is clearly in the driver's seat and doing quite well.
